A Career Advancement Programme in Service Management Change equips professionals with the skills and knowledge to navigate the complexities of organizational transformation. The programme focuses on developing strategic thinking, change leadership, and effective communication within service management contexts.
Learning outcomes include mastering ITIL frameworks, understanding change management methodologies like ADKAR and Prosci, and developing proficiency in project management techniques vital for successful service transitions. Participants gain practical experience through simulations and case studies, enhancing their ability to implement change initiatives effectively.
The duration of the programme typically ranges from several weeks to several months, depending on the intensity and level of specialization offered. This allows for a thorough exploration of service management change principles and their practical application within diverse organizational settings.
